Filing 73 ORDER entered by Judge Michael M. Mihm on 2/25/10. 64 Motion for Summary Judgment is GRANTED IN PART and DENIED IN PART. The Motion is granted with respect to the Alfanos' Section 1983 substantive due process claim, for the reason that their claim is more accurately one under the Fourth Amendment. The motion is additionally granted with respect to the Alfanos' Section 1983 "class of one" Equal Protection claim. The motion is denied with respect to the Alfanos' Secti on 1983 claim for Fourth Amendment unreasonable seizure and state law claims based upon respondeat superior and Section 9-102 of the Illinois Local Governmental Tort Immunity Act. The Court will contact the parties in the near future to schedule the Final Pretrial Conference. SEE FULL ORDER ATTACHED. (FDT, ilcd) |
